With only the rare upset—like last week’s Steele Canyon win over Helix—there has been little movement among the Sportswriters/Sportscasters and Union-Tribune Top 10 polls the last few weeks.
That could change a lot over the next three weeks, starting this weekend where there are three big showdowns as the league races heat up.
No. 2 La Costa Canyon (7-0) hosts Top 10 Escondido (6-0-1) in a 7 p.m. Avocado League showdown that not only has huge implications for the league title but the No. 1 seed in the Division I playoffs. Remember these were the two teams in last year’s Division I title game won by La Costa Canyon, 45-28.
Then there is the first of three straight Valley League biggies as unbeaten Ramona (7-0) travels to equally perfect Valley Center (7-0) for a 7 p.m. game. No. 1 Oceanside, which is ranked No. 4 in the state and plays Orange Glen, meets Valley Center and Ramona during the last two weeks of the regular season.
A game with major State Bowl Playoff implications is the Saturday afternoon clash at Santa Fe Christian where the Eagles (7-0), ranked No. 3 in the Southern California Small School Division, host No. 1 Francis Parker (6-1).
Although neither are ranked among the section’s Top 10 teams, there may not be any better football teams in the state for the schools their size. Although both are Coastal League members, they will not meet in the section playoffs as SFC has opted to play up to Division IV.
